Tucker Carlson is launching his own book imprint called Tucker Carlson Books with Skyhorse Publishing, according to major media reports. According to The Independent - Main, Tucker Carlson described the imprint as seeking books that 'nobody else will publish'. Skyhorse publisher Tony Lyons said Carlson's imprint would provide a platform to things that would often be shut down or censored, and that his publishing house offers 'free speech' works that other companies wouldn't publish, according to major media reports.

Titles slated for release under Tucker Carlson's imprint include Russell Brand's upcoming book 'How To Become a Christian In Seven Days' and Milo Yiannopoulos's book 'Ex Gay', according to major media reports. Milo Yiannopoulos resigned from Breitbart News in 2017 after footage resurfaced where he appeared to condone sexual relationships between men and underage boys, and he apologized at the time and said he had been a victim of sexual abuse; he was permanently banned from Facebook and Twitter in 2019 for breaking hate speech rules, according to major media reports. Since Carlson was fired from Fox News in 2023, he has gone on to launch his own digital media company, and he has hosted highly controversial guests on his streaming show, including white nationalist Nick Fuentes, according to major media reports. In recent weeks, Carlson became one of several MAGA acolytes who have split from President Donald Trump over the ongoing conflict in Iran, and President Donald Trump described Tucker Carlson and others as having 'Low IQs', according to major media reports.

Other authors published under Skyhorse include Health Secretary Robert F. Kennedy Jr, first lady Melania Trump, and Woody Allen, according to major media reports. The exact launch date for Tucker Carlson Books, the number of books planned for the initial release, and specific sales or distribution plans remain unknown.
